Synopsis

Known as 'B,' a legendary warrior who has witnessed countless civilizations rise and fall, seeks an end to his immortality. A U.S. black-ops group offers him a way to die, but only if he helps them first. Their alliance takes an unexpected turn when a mortal soldier inexplicably returns to life, revealing a powerful, mysterious force with its own agenda.

Keanu Charles Reeves is a Canadian actor born in Beirut and raised in Toronto. He gained recognition with roles in "Bill & Ted's Excellent Adventure" and "Point Break," later achieving stardom as Neo in "The Matrix" series. Reeves has showcased versatility in various genres, from indie dramas to action blockbusters. Beyond acting, Reeves has directed a film, played bass in a band, and engaged in philanthropy. China Tom Miéville (pronounced /ˈtʃaɪnə miˈeɪvəl/; born 6 September 1972 in Norwich) is an award-winning English fantasy fiction writer. He is fond of describing his work as "weird fiction" (after early 20th century pulp and horror writers such as H. P. Lovecraft), and belongs to a loose group of writers sometimes called New Weird who consciously attempt to move fantasy away from commercial, genre clichés of Tolkien epigones.
